As the Men’s Asia Cup 2025 progresses further, in match number nine, Bangladesh will lock horns with Afghanistan in Group B clash at the Sheikh Zayed Cricket Stadium in Abu Dhabi on Tuesday, September 16. While the Litton Das-led side are coming after a defeat against Sri Lanka, Afghanistan registered a convincing 94-run win over Hong Kong in their opening match.
But as the tournament gets intense with the fight for the Super Four on, Afghanistan head coach Jonathan Trott was asked several questions, while speaking of the team’s preparation ahead of their upcoming game. When asked if Bangladesh would be under pressure in the game against Afghanistan, Jonathan Trott quipped, “Yes, I think Bangladesh will be under pressure.”
Jonathan Trott confirms via Google on Bangladesh’s Asia Cup win
Trott further continued, claiming that Bangladesh have won the competition a few times to which a journalist quickly came up, clearing out that Bangladesh have never lifted the Asia Cup. To this, Trott repeatedly asked, “Are you sure?” Eventually, Afghanistan media manager stepped up while Trott insisted, “I thought they won the 50-over Asia Cup,” googling in his press conference.

Speaking of the competition, Afghanistan are placed second in the Group B with one win in as many games. Bangladesh on the other hand, are third with a solitary win in two games. Sri Lanka currently sits at the top, almost confirming their Super Four berth in the Asia Cup 2025.
